
从零开始用Rufus打造完美ESXi 7.0安装U盘的终极指南当你第一次接触服务器虚拟化时最令人头疼的往往不是复杂的配置过程而是最基础的安装介质准备。作为虚拟化领域的基石ESXi 7.0的安装U盘制作看似简单实则暗藏玄机。本文将带你深入理解这一关键步骤避开那些让新手抓狂的陷阱。1. 准备工作工具与材料的选择艺术在开始制作安装U盘前选择合适的硬件和软件工具至关重要。一个8GB以上的优质U盘是基础但并非所有U盘都适合作为ESXi安装介质。我曾在项目中使用过某品牌廉价U盘结果在安装过程中频繁报错最终发现是U盘主控芯片与ESXi兼容性问题。推荐工具清单Rufus 3.18或更新版本官网获取最新版官方ESXi 7.0 ISO镜像SHA256校验通过容量≥8GB的USB 3.0 U盘建议三星、闪迪等品牌注意避免使用USB 2.0 U盘虽然理论上可行但实际安装速度会慢得令人难以忍受。2. Rufus配置详解模式选择的科学启动Rufus后界面看似简单但每个选项都直接影响安装成功率。以下是关键配置项的深度解析配置项推荐值技术原理分区方案GPT兼容UEFI和传统BIOS启动目标系统UEFI (非CSM)现代服务器的最佳选择文件系统FAT32ESXi引导加载程序兼容性最佳簇大小默认对安装介质影响不大写入模式的选择DD模式原始扇区写入适合特殊硬件环境ISO镜像模式标准写入方式推荐大多数情况使用在实际测试中我们发现DD模式在某些服务器主板上启动成功率更高但会牺牲U盘后续使用的便利性。而ISO模式则更加通用且制作后的U盘可以继续存储其他文件。3. 制作过程中的常见问题与解决方案即使按照标准流程操作仍可能遇到各种意外情况。以下是几个典型问题及应对策略问题1Rufus提示镜像不完整重新下载ESXi ISO文件验证SHA256校验和尝试更换USB接口优先使用主板原生接口问题2服务器无法识别启动U盘检查BIOS/UEFI设置中的安全启动状态尝试不同的USB端口某些服务器对前置端口支持不佳更新服务器主板固件至最新版本问题3安装过程中出现Failed to load modules错误重新制作安装介质更换U盘品牌金士顿和三星通常兼容性最佳降低Rufus版本至3.14某些特殊情况下有效4. 验证安装介质确保万无一失制作完成的U盘需要经过严格验证才能用于生产环境。我推荐以下验证流程基础检查确认U盘根目录存在EFI和ISOLINUX文件夹检查boot.cfg文件内容是否完整虚拟机测试qemu-system-x86_64 -enable-kvm -m 4096 -hda /dev/sdX将/dev/sdX替换为你的U盘设备节点观察能否正常进入安装界面物理机快速验证在备用服务器上尝试启动观察是否能够加载ESXi安装程序内核5. 高级技巧定制化安装介质对于有特殊需求的高级用户可以考虑对安装介质进行定制集成驱动# 使用ESXi-Customizer工具集成第三方驱动 ./ESXi-Customizer -iz esxi70.iso -oz custom-esxi70.iso -d vmxnet3-driver.vib预配置安装参数 编辑ks.cfg文件实现无人值守安装包含网络配置、root密码等设置vmaccepteula rootpw MySecurePassword123! network --bootprotostatic --ip192.168.1.100 --netmask255.255.255.0 --gateway192.168.1.1 --nameserver8.8.8.8 install --firstdisk --overwritevmfs在最近的一个数据中心部署项目中我们通过定制化安装介质将30台服务器的部署时间从8小时缩短到不足2小时效率提升显著。6. 性能优化从制作到安装的全流程提速制作安装介质只是开始如何优化整个过程才是专业运维人员的追求U盘性能基准测试# Linux下测试U盘写入速度 hdparm -tT /dev/sdX # Windows可使用CrystalDiskMark制作过程加速技巧关闭所有杀毒软件实时防护将ISO文件放在NVMe SSD上再进行写入使用USB 3.2 Gen2接口如有安装过程优化在服务器BIOS中开启USB 3.0 XHCI Hand-off提前连接所有需要识别的硬盘禁用不必要的硬件设备如集成显卡记得在一次紧急恢复中这些优化技巧帮助我们在一台老旧服务器上成功完成了ESXi安装而标准方法则持续失败。有时候正是这些细节决定成败。